Summary

Dr. Heather Patton is a gastroenterologist and internal medicine physician who earned their medical degree from the University of Michigan Medical School. With 28 years of experience in practice, they bring extensive knowledge to digestive health and comprehensive internal medicine care. Dr. Patton is fluent in both Spanish and English, helping them connect with a diverse patient population.

They practice at University of California San Diego Jacobs Medical Center and Jennifer Moreno Department of Veterans Affairs Medical Center in San Diego, California. Dr. Patton specializes in treating complex liver conditions including cirrhosis and acute fatty liver of pregnancy. They also provide care for metabolic conditions such as high cholesterol in children and teens. Patients have given Dr. Patton an average rating of 5.0, reflecting their commitment to quality care.
